Verified trades
Verified suppliers
Verified reorders
32 total purchases
1 total suppliers
Shaft (158 shipments)
Solar Module (90 shipments)
Worm (57 shipments)
NIDEC MOTORS AND ACTUATORS (318 orders)
NIDEC AUTOMOTIVE MOTOR AMERICAS LLC (96 orders)
M S HARLEY DAVIDSON MOTOR (32 orders)